An algebra tile configuration where the 2 largest tiles are labeled plus x squared, there are 4 tiles labeled negative x, where

each tile is half the size of the largest tiles, and 6 tiles labeled minus that are each one-quarter the size of the largest tile. Which polynomial is represented by the algebra tiles? 2x2 – 4x – 6 2x2 + 4x + 6 –2x2 – 4x – 6 –2x2 + 4x + 6

Answer:

The polynomial is 2x² - 4x - 6 ⇒ 1st answer

Step-by-step explanation:

* <em>Lets explain how to solve the problem</em>

- Algebra tiles are used to model integers and variables to aid in

 learning how to write polynomials

- There are two largest tiles labeled plus x squared

- That means we have two x²

∴ There are 2x²

- There are 4 tiles labeled negative x, where each tile is half the size

 of the largest tiles

- That means we have 4 negative x

∴ There are 4 × -x = -4x

- There are 6 tiles labeled minus that are each one-quarter the size

 of the largest tile

- That means we have 6 negative signs (6 - ones)

∴ There are 6 × - ones = -6

∴ The polynomial = 2x² + (-4x) + (-6)

- <u><em>Remember:</em></u> (+)(-) = (-)

∴ The polynomial = 2x² - 4x - 6

* The polynomial is 2x² - 4x - 6
